Motorola Moto G Stylus vs. Honor Play5 5G specs

Motorola Moto G Stylus is the latest product of the Motorola brand, while the Honor Play5 5G comes with a robust chipset and unique design. For the display, Motorola Moto G Stylus specs come with a 6.4-inch IPS LCD with a resolution of 1080 x 2300 pixels. Meanwhile, the Honor Play5 5G specs flaunt a 6.53-inch OLED (1080 x 2400 pixels). In the first round, the Honor phone gets one point because of the higher screen size.

Moreover, both devices run on Android 10 as the operating system, but the Honor device has no Google Play Services. Plus, the Motorola device draws power from the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 chipset as the processor. Meanwhile, the Honor handset takes power from the latest MediaTek Dimensity 800U 5G chipset. For storage, the Motorola handset sports 4GB of RAM and 128GB of onboard memory. It also supports a microSDXC card that can expandable to 256GB!

 

Honor Play5 5G

On the other side, the Honor phone comes with two variants: 128GB/ 256GB of internal storage and 8GB of RAM. As a result, the Honor new phone becomes the winner of the second round with better RAM. How about the optics department and battery aspect? Motorola Moto G Stylus camera rocks a triple lens at the rear setup. It includes a 48MP + 16MP + 2MP. Moving around the front, this device carries a single 16MP shooter for taking selfies and video calls. Besides, the Honor Play5 5G camera offers a quad 64MP + 8MP + 2MP + 2MP sensors. Moreover, it also has a single 16MP sensor for taking selfies and video calls. How about the capacity? The Motorola smartphone carries a massive 4000mAh juice box while the other houses a 3800mAh. In these rounds, the Honor phone has one more point because of more massive cameras.

Motorola Moto G Stylus specs

According to our source, Motorola is scheduled to announce on February 23rd to debut the Moto G8 series smartphone, including the Moto G8, the Moto G8 Power, and the Moto G Stylus. These smartphones come with a hole-punch display upfront. Today, our spotlight belongs to Moto G Stylus. Regarding the display, the Moto G Stylus specs arrive with a 6.4-inch IPS LCD with a resolution of 1080 x 2300 pixels.

Under the hood, the Moto G Stylus phone works on Android 10 as the operating system. Additionally, the Motorola phone gets power from the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 chipset with the Adreno 610 GPU as the processor. Moving on to the memory, this device sports 4GB of RAM and 128GB of inbuilt storage. How about the battery? This device draws power from a non-removable Li-Po 4000mAh battery cell that supports fast charging.

Motorola Moto G Stylus

On the other side, in terms of the camera department, the Moto G Stylus camera rocks a triple camera setup on the back. It comprises of a 48MP primary lens (f/1.7) + 16MP ultra-wide sensor (f/2.2) + 2MP lens (f/2.2). Back to the front, this smartphone features a single 16MP lens with an aperture of f/2.0 for taking selfies and video calling. On the back, there is a rear-mounted fingerprint scanner for security.
